Sun Lotus city, marketplace
There was a huge commotion at the city's marketplace. The people were coming and going hastily. The merchants were having trouble keeping up with the flock of customers. Some have even run out of merchandise to sell and had to pack up their stand.
This all was the consequence of the cultivation frenzy that the city lord Ding Shuren unleashed with the announcement of the cultivation boards.
Gu masters needed resources to cultivate. Primeval stones to replenish their essence, gu worms to help their cultivation, and gu materials to feed their gu.
And the city lord's decree ensured that the prices of these things would go up.
Some people were not happy about this. They were the commoner gu masters who could not afford the higher prices. But there were also those who were excited about it. The merchants and wealthy gu masters were in an advantageous position now.
In the middle of all this commotion, there was a young man who was calmly making his way through the crowd. He was neither in a hurry nor did he look flustered. He was just strolling through the marketplace as if he didn't have a care in the world.
Bao Zhi was browsing the wares on display at a particular stand.
"How much for this gu worm?" - He asked the seller, pointing at a rank one gu worm.
The seller was preoccupied with haggling with another gu master, he turned to Bao Zhi and said:
"These rank one gu worms are one hundred primeval stones. If you want a rank two gu worm, you will have to pay eight hundred primeval stones." - Came the reply before the seller turned back to the other customer.
Bao Zhi frowned. The prices of gu worms have risen above their previous market value. He considered only for a moment.
"I will buy three of this gu worm." - He said, taking out a bag of primeval stones.
Bao Zhi was not the only one who had acquired a gu worm. Many gu masters have also bought their own gu. The gu worms that could aid cultivation were the hottest items currently.
Gu worms were not easy to find. They were rare and precious in the wild. There were only a few who knew how to tame and cultivate gu worms among gu masters.
Bao Zhi put away his newly acquired gu worms, the rank one Earthworm gu. The Earthworm gu had an unremarkable appearance. It was fat and fist-sized with a dark brown color. This gu worm could burrow into the ground and move around as its owner controlled. Naturally, it was not very popular among the buyers due to the current circumstances.
Next, he visited another stand. He found the gu worm he was looking for. It was a rank one Powder gu.
Powder gu was a gu worm known for its ability to produce a dust-like powder. It was mostly useless in combat or cultivation but it could be used as an ingredient for many things, such as creating gu poisons, or gu refinement.
Bao Zhi bought the Powder gu for two hundred primeval stones.
As he turned away from the stand, he bumped into someone.
Advertisement
"Sorry." - Bao Zhi said.
"No problem."
Bao Zhi turned to the other person. He was a young man wearing a green robe. He was handsome and had an elegant bearing.
The other person looked at Bao Zhi.
"You!" - He exclaimed.
"You are?" - Bao Zhi did not recall who this person was.
"I was your opponent, at the academy's tournament. Ye Jianhong!" - Replied the young master of the Ye family angrily.
Bao Zhi took a step back.
"What do you want? You lost to me fairly. Why are you angry?" - He asked, pretending to be confused.
"This fool is looking for trouble with me. Typical and hot-headed." - Bao Zhi thought to himself.
"I am angry because you humiliated me! I lost to you because I was not strong enough. But I will not lose to you a second time!" - Ye Jianhong said, grinding his teeth.
"I don't want to fight you. Aren't you here to make a purchase? Let bygones be bygones. Both of us are better off that way." - Bao Zhi said, trying to placate Ye Jianhong.
"I am not like you! I will not rest until I take my revenge! If I can't fight you directly, then I will defeat you in the competition on the cultivation board!" - Ye Jianhong declared.
Bao Zhi sighed.
"You are really not giving up, are you? I don't want to fight you, but if you insist, I will not hold back." - He said.
Ye Jianhong did not reply. He turned away and walked in the opposite direction.
Bao Zhi watched him go.
"What a pain." - He muttered to himself, before turning back his attention to the marketplace.

Later that same day Bao Zhi returned to his house. His trip to the marketplace was successful, he could buy each of the items he set out to get.
Meanwhile, in his own room, Jin Ju was still cultivating quietly. He was using the Unprocessed Jade gu to raise his aptitude to A grade.
Bao Zhi looked at the silent Jin Ju and couldn't help but sigh, this little fellow was quite impressive now compared to before.
Bao Zhi did not disturb him and headed to his own room. He sat down and started to unpack his newly acquired goods.
He inspected them once again, now even more thoroughly than at the stalls.
After the third round of inspections, he carefully arranged them in order.
"Let's begin." - He muttered.
He first took out the Powder gu and instilled his primeval essence into it. The rank one gu worm was already refined by him on his way home.
Soon a small pile of dark powder was produced.
Bao Zhi took a bowl of powder and started to throw in various gu materials.
Three stalks of spring dew grass...
One catti of white silkworm...
Twelve petals of scarlet dusk flower...
Bao Zhi added more and more items from his list.
Once all the gu materials were thrown into the bowl, he used his primeval essence to crush them into a fine dust.
Advertisement
"It seems like it is enough." - He muttered.
He took the bowl in his hand and shook it very gently. When the materials were evenly mixed, he took out his bag of primeval stones.
One primeval stone...
Two primeval stones...
Ten primeval stones...
...
Fifty primeval stones later a thin, white colored film started to form on the top.
Bao Zhi knew this was the critical amount. He stopped his actions to observe carefully. Next, he took out the rank one Earthworm gu and skillfully tossed it into the center of the bowl.
The bowl started to rock left and right, and the thin layer of film engulfed the Earthworm gu all around.
The fat Earthworm gu started to rise above the bowl. It was connected by a thin pillar to the mass below in the bowl.
The Earthworm gu started to rotate faster and faster, and it was engulfed by the film all around.
This was the last step. Bao Zhi concentrated and reached out with his primeval essence toward the gu worm.
But then! At the very last moment, the bowl started to shake violently, and the thin pillar to the Earthworm gu was broken.
The gu worm started to fall!
Bao Zhi reacted very quickly, reaching out with his primeval essence he grabbed the gu worm and stopped its fall.
The gu worm was still shaking and going through spasms. The entire process was very painful, and the gu worm was trying to escape the pain.
Its entire body was distorted and turned into a strange shape. A moment later the gu worm perished.
"A failure." - Bao Zhi accepted calmly.
Refining new gu worms were difficult. One needed not only good materials and refinement expertise, a good portion was simply up to random chance.
Precisely because of this, gu refinement was an endless sink in the history of gu cultivation. The higher the rank of the gu the smaller the chance.
A good gu recipe could mitigate the resources wasted and raise the chance as well.
"I still have two Earthworm gu left. But before I start again I have to recover my essence."
Bao Zhi took out a fistful of primeval stones and started to absorb them.
"Let's try again. I need to be more careful at the last part." - He reminded himself.
This gu recipe was a new creation of his. So he still needed some practice with this specific gu recipe.
One thing was theory and another was practice. The gap between the two needed to be bridged now.
During the second try, the Earthworm fully absorbed the mass from the bowl below. Its color has changed to an off-white, and small green veins were showing on its sides.
Bao Zhi observed the still transforming gu worm before him, there were no more steps in the refinement left.
"Oh no!"
Before Bao Zhi could react, the gu worm exploded with a small puff. It splattered on the ground as a small patch of viscous goo.
"Tsk. It seems the last step was too fast. I need to proceed more slowly, and let it absorb at a more gradual pace." - He analyzed the events.
"The last batch..." - He sighed.
Bao Zhi estimated the success rate of this recipe to be about sixty to seventy percent. But that was only the recipe. If he made a mistake, the refinement was destined to fail regardless.
He cleaned up the failed refinement and prepared to try again.
This time he was more careful, and he proceeded with the last step even more slowly.
The process was very tedious, and it took him a full night to complete.
But, the results were satisfactory. The last batch was a complete success, and he finally refined this gu worm!
A brand new gu worm!
Bao Zhi took the gu in his palm. He was a little excited.
The gu has shrunk in size compared to its original form. Now it was only the size of an adult's thumb. The color of the gu was milk-white with some green marks on the sides.
It was wiggling left and right on Bao Zhi's palm as he willed it.
"What should I name you?" - He hasn't thought of a name yet while deducing this new gu recipe.
He did not want to name it something too common. But giving it an intricate name would also be meaningless as he would keep the gu for himself.
"Hmm... I'll name you simply Flesh Worm gu." - He decided.
"Now then..." - His expression turned serious.
Bao Zhi was eager to test out his new creation. He took a sharp knife in his hand. Next, he pointed the tip at his left forearm. Then with determination, he made a shallow incision on his skin.
His blood started to drip on the ground, but he was undisturbed by this.
Next, he took the Flesh Worm gu and placed it next to the fresh wound.
The worm wiggled on his skin, feeling its way around. Soon, it latched onto the cut and burrowed into Bao Zhi's arm directly!
Bao Zhi gritted his teeth as he endured the harsh pain. He could feel the worm crawling around under his skin. It maneuvered around his tendons and bones delving deeper and deeper.
"Good. Now let's try its effect."
He activated the gu worm. The Flesh Worm bit at his flesh and started to consume his muscles from the inside!
Bao Zhi was sweating profusely, he had to concentrate to endure this intense agony and not faint.
As the worm was eating its way forward, it was leaving a path filled with new material behind it. The wound that it created slowly healed back again due to Bao Zhi's strong vitality.
...
An hour later he had to stop, as he was shaking from exhaustion. His breathing was rough.
"The side effects are stronger than expected, this will limit the speed of my progress... But this method is working!" - He collapsed to the ground with an eerie grin on his face.
"This gu can finally refine the dao marks on my body!"
"With this, I can cultivate these dao marks into a killer move eventually."
